When Morrison, Hendrix and Joplin died from drug overdoses, I didn't blink an eye, but when Sandy Denny died 3 weeks after falling down a flight of stairs, and hitting her head on concrete,(probably drunk), I was truly torn down. I still don't think I'm over it yet. To think of what she could have become. She was the only person to make a guest appearance on a Led Zeppelin album, among other things.
